You are trying to determine the identity of an unknown metal object using density. You measure the volume by displacement using

a graduated cylinder. The initial volume is 14.7 mL, and the final volume is 23.5 mL. The mass is measured using a balance and is determined to be 68.895 g. The calculation you use to find the answer is: $$

The formula you use is Density = (mass) / (volume) .

The calculation for this particular object is

Density = (68.895 g) / (23.5 mL - 14.7 mL)

Density = (68.895 g) / (8.8 mL)

<em>Density = 7.8 g/mL</em>

The direction of a natural process is indicated by which of the following? A. conservation of energy. B. change in entropy C. th
Afina-wow [57]

Answer:

The correct answer is option'B': Change in entropy

Explanation:

We know from the second law of thermodynamics for any spontaneous process the total entropy of the system and it's surroundings will increase.

Meaning that any unaided process will  move in a direction in which the entropy of the system will increase.It is because the system will always want to increase it's randomness
